Bowen Hanes & Co. Inc. lessened its holdings in shares of Intuitive Surgical, Inc. (NASDAQ:ISRG – Free Report) by 0.3% during the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 184,315 shares of the medical equipment provider’s stock after selling 615 shares during the quarter. Intuitive Surgical makes up about 2.5% of Bowen Hanes & Co. Inc.’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 7th biggest position. Bowen Hanes & Co. Inc.’s holdings in Intuitive Surgical were worth $91,286,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Intuitive Surgical Price Performance
Shares of Intuitive Surgical stock opened at $481.28 on Tuesday. The business has a 50-day moving average of $507.85 and a 200-day moving average of $524.14. The company has a market capitalization of $172.53 billion, a PE ratio of 67.12, a P/E/G ratio of 5.03 and a beta of 1.59. Intuitive Surgical, Inc. has a 1-year low of $425.00 and a 1-year high of $616.00.
Insider Transactions at Intuitive Surgical
In other news, insider Gary S. Guthart sold 7,893 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Monday, July 28th. The shares were sold at an average price of $498.64, for a total transaction of $3,935,765.52. Following the transaction, the insider owned 13,187 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$6,575,565.68. This trade represents a 37.44% decrease in their ownership of the stock. About Intuitive Surgical
Intuitive Surgical, Inc develops, manufactures, and markets products that enable physicians and healthcare providers to enhance the quality of and access to minimally invasive care in the United States and internationally. The company offers the da Vinci Surgical System that enables complex surgery using a minimally invasive approach; and Ion endoluminal system, which extends its commercial offerings beyond surgery into diagnostic procedures enabling minimally invasive biopsies in the lung.
